Auditions for Miss Culture 2018 on

Sebini Cultural Event will host Miss Culture 2018, a beauty contest focused on reviving Setswana culture.

The event coordinator Refilwe Senna told Mmegi that the pageant was meant to showcase different Setswana cultures. She said they came up with the pageantry on the realisation that many youths did not know their culture. 

“This beauty pageant is open for all the youth across the country. We have not limited the number of contestants, as this contest is open for tribes across the country. We do not want to leave any tribe behind. We expect the contestants to research and showcase their different cultures. We want our youth to be proud of their tribes and their cultures,” she said.
